AI builder stopping

Maybe this doesn't fall under bugs, but I really didn't know where it did, so I posted it here. Feel free to move this if it isn't.

The other day, I was running a test on the AI builders map, but when I looked at the graphs at the end of the run, I saw that all the teams stopped expanding after about one and a half hour. Why is this? Do they reach a maximum amount of buildings? Or do they run out of gold to train more citizens? It also surprised me to see that they had quite little serfs, for the size of their cities.

Re: AI builder stopping

@FeyBart: Stop offtopic-ing please.

KaM Remake AI is programmed to reach certain goal, in terms of town that is have sufficient food and armaments production (other wares as well). Once the desired level reached (there's more food/gold/iron/etc made than consumed) the AI will stop building.
